Charles Schwab Q3 Profit Rises 32%; Results Top Estimates

(RTTNews) - Financial services firm Charles Schwab Corp. (SCHW) reported Monday that net income available to common shareholders for the third quarter grew to $2.02 billion or $0.99 per share from $1.53 billion or $0.74 per share in the year-ago quarter.

Excluding items, adjusted earnings for the quarter were $1.10 per share, compared to $0.84 per share in the prior-year quarter.

Net revenues for the quarter grew 20 percent to $5.50 billion from $4.57 billion in the same quarter last year.

On average, analysts polled by Thomson Reuters expected the company to report earnings of $1.05 per share on revenues of $5.41 billion for the quarter. Analysts' estimates typically exclude special items.
